Greetings, As of 11:00 am this morning (Monday), the Male Harlequin Duck was located where it has been reported, north of North Point on Milwaukee's Lakefront. It was in with a small group of Buffleheads out a ways. I did not see any Snowy Owls on the lakefront. A Redhead and Horned Grebe were among many Scaup's and Goldeneye's at the petroleum pier.
